The oldest works for the exploration of gold date, at least, from the time of the Roman occupation of the Iberian Peninsula. A testimony to this activity is the existence, mainly in the Santa Justa and Pias Mountains, of a mining complex consisting of several fojos and sections dating from the 1st to the 3rd centuries.

The Fojo das Pombas is the most emblematic, as it is possible to observe the integration of several techniques used by the Romans and also because several pieces have been found in this place that confirm the age of the exploration. Highlight for its singular beauty and exuberance due to the flora that develops due to its particular edaphoclimatic conditions.
